Summary:
Using hand and power tools, a metal finisher removes dents, scratches, and defects from metal surfaces. As a metal finisher, your job duties include grinding, sanding, and filling uneven surfaces, polishing and coating metal, and etching decorative details.
Responsibilities:
- Grinds, files, or sands surfaces of metal items using hand tools, power tools, and knowledge of metal finishing techniques.
- Examines and feels surface of metal to detect defects, like dents, scratches, or breaks in metal.
- Removes dents, using hammer dolly block and fills uneven surface with molten solder.
- Smooths surface of item to specified finish, using hand tools powered tools.
- May polish metal surfaces, using a powered polishing wheel or belt
- Mount’s workpiece in holding device, manually or using a hoist.
- Verifies dimensions of finished workpiece, using measuring devices.
